Transaction 57fbd15031bcec7993597050d085bfe125ac2500c571cc58f42c6bf881c10791
1 Input
1 Output
-
57fbd15031bcec7993597050d085bfe125ac2500c571cc58f42c6bf881c10791:0
- value
- 1001345
- script pubkey
- OP_0 OP_PUSHBYTES_20 21a457954d0d876441373492c086c18a1a4c1a49
- address
- bc1qyxj9092dpkrkgsfhxjfvppkp3gdycxjf26pef9